By 2100, billions of people are at risk of facing more flooding, higher temperatures and less food and water. A new study published in Nature Climate Change found that the climate change will cause the Earth s tropical rain belt to unevenly shift in areas that cover almost two-thirds of the world, potentially threatening environmental safety and food security for billions of people. 
The tropical rain belt, otherwise known as the Intertropical Convergence Zone, or ITCZ, is a narrow area that circles the Earth near the equator where trade winds from the Northern and Southern hemispheres meet. Areas along the equator are among the warmest on Earth, and this, paired with the winds, creates significant humidity and precipitation.  ....

A new study suggests a potential change in tropical rain belt patterns could threaten the livelihoods and food security of billions of people.
Today, the tropical rain belt brings with it heavy precipitation along the equator, but as different parts of Earth s atmosphere heat up at different rates, this belt looks likely to become disrupted as it gets attracted to warmer regions of air – threatening biodiversity and taking away the water that people rely on, including growing crops.
 
Researchers analysed 27 of the most up-to-date climate models to reach their conclusions, but the full impact of the climate crisis on the tropical rain belt only became clear when they isolated the effects on the Eastern and Western Hemispheres, and studied them separately. ....

Future climate change will cause a regionally uneven shifting of the tropical rain belt - a narrow band of heavy precipitation near the equator - according to researchers at the University of California, Irvine and other institutions. This development may threaten food security for billions of people.
In a study published today in
Nature Climate Change, the interdisciplinary team of environmental engineers, Earth system scientists and data science experts stressed that not all parts of the tropics will be affected equally. For instance, the rain belt will move north in parts of the Eastern Hemisphere but will move south in areas in the Western Hemisphere. ....
